以下答案由GPT-3.5大模型与博主波罗歌共同编写:
J-A磁滞模型是描述铁磁体磁滞行为的一种模型,它描述了铁磁体在外部磁场作用下,磁化强度与磁场之间的关系。该模型的基本方程为:
$B = \mu_0(H + M)$
其中,$B$为磁感应强度,$H$为外部磁场强度,$M$为磁化强度,$\mu_0$为真空磁导率。
J-A磁滞模型引入了五个参数,分别为饱和磁化强度$M_s$、剩磁强度$M_r$、磁滞系数$a$、晶格磁畴壁能$k$和磁畴壁宽度$x_0$。这五个参数可以用来描述铁磁体的物理特性,即石墨烯膜沉积方法对于J-A磁滞性能的影响
与施加在磁体表面的压力之间,J-A磁滞模型的五个参数并没有明确的对应关系。因为压力的施加可能会影响磁畴结构的形变和排列,从而影响这些参数的值,但这些影响的具体表达式很难被明确地表达出来。
当然,也可以考虑引入一些新的参数,如应力系数等,来描述压力对磁滞模型的影响。但这需要进一步的研究来确定。
以下是使用Python实现J-A磁滞模型的代码示例:
import numpy as np
def JA_model(H, Ms, Mr, a, k, x0):
M = np.zeros_like(H)
for i in range(len(H)):
if H[i]>0:
M[i] = Ms*(1 - np.exp(-a*H[i]/(Ms+k*x0)))
elif H[i]<=0:
M[i] = -Ms*(1 - np.exp(a*H[i]/(Ms-k*x0)))
B = np.zeros_like(H)
for i in range(len(H)):
B[i] = np.sign(M[i])*np.sqrt((M[i]+Mr)**2 + H[i]**2)
return B
该代码可用于计算铁磁体在一定外部磁场下的磁感应强度。其中,输入参数为外部磁场强度$H$和J-A磁滞模型的五个参数$Ms$、$Mr$、$a$、$k$和$x0$,输出为相应的磁感应强度$B$。
如果我的回答解决了您的问题,请采纳!